"e;Decoding The Giver"e; explores the complexities of Lois Lowry's dystopian classic, "e;The Giver."e; Designed to enhance your understanding and enjoyment of the novel, this guide is perfect for students and literature enthusiasts alike.This guide includes:Detailed Summary: A chapter-by-chapter breakdown of the novel, ensuring you grasp the main events and themes.Character Analysis: Detailed profiles of main and minor characters, including their relationships and growth throughout the novel.Theme Exploration: In-depth exploration of major themes, such as the importance of individuality, the value of memory, and the necessity of pain and suffering.Literary Device Examination: Insight into how Lowry uses symbolism, foreshadowing, and other literary techniques to create a layered and meaningful narrative.Conflict Analysis: A study of the main internal and external conflicts in the novel, and how they drive the narrative and character development.Moral and Ethical Discussions: Examining the ethical dilemmas presented in the novel prompts readers to reflect on their values and beliefs.Cross-disciplinary Connections: Explore how "e;The Giver"e; intersects with sociology, psychology, and history disciplines."e;Decoding The Giver"e; is designed to deepen your comprehension of "e;The Giver"e; and its rich themes, encouraging critical thinking and making your reading experience more engaging and enlightening. Whether you're reading for a class, a book club, or for personal enjoyment, our study guide to "e;The Giver"e; is an essential companion.
